MIT Study Reveals Medical AI Models Fail on Up to 75% of New Data Despite Strong Overall Performance

MIT researchers discover that medical AI models appearing highly effective can catastrophically fail on up to 75% of new data when deployed in different hospital settings, with chest X-ray diagnostic systems missing critical conditions like pleural diseases due to spurious correlations that aren't caught by standard performance metrics.
